The Rise of Eco-Friendly Automotive Care: What You Need to Know

As environmental concerns grow, eco-friendly automotive care is becoming increasingly popular among vehicle owners. Not only does it contribute to a healthier planet, but it can also save you money. Here’s what you need to know about sustainable practices in automotive care:

1. Use Eco-Friendly Products

Opting for biodegradable cleaning products and eco-friendly oils is a great first step. Many companies now offer products that are less harmful to the environment while still providing effective results for your vehicle.

2. Regular Maintenance

Keeping your vehicle well-maintained is one of the best ways to minimize its environmental impact. A well-tuned vehicle runs more efficiently, reducing emissions and fuel consumption. Regular checks and services help achieve this efficiency.

3. Tire Maintenance

Proper tire maintenance can greatly reduce your vehicle's fuel consumption. Keep tires properly inflated and aligned to improve gas mileage. Remember that under-inflated tires can lead to increased CO2 emissions.

4. Embrace Carpooling and Public Transport

Whenever possible, opt for carpooling or public transportation. This reduces the number of vehicles on the road and lowers overall emissions. If your commute allows, consider biking or walking as eco-friendly alternatives.

5. Recycle Old Parts

When replacing automotive parts, be sure to recycle the old components responsibly. Many auto shops have programs in place to recycle metals and plastics, reducing landfill waste.

Conclusion

Embracing eco-friendly automotive care is not just a trend; it is a responsibility we should all consider. By implementing sustainable practices in your vehicle maintenance routine, you can help protect the environment while also benefiting from cost savings.
